Grant Description
The purpose of this agreement is to fund research supporting the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ency (DARPA) Biological Technologies Offices (BTO) Arcadia Program. This effort shall be carried out generally as set forth in Exhibit B, Research Description Document, dated September 8, 2022, and in the recipient's revised proposal titled "Microbes Achieve Resistance to Microorganism Influenced Rust – Armor: An Integrated Platform for Defeating Corrosion," dated September 8, 2022. Copies of these documents are in the possession of both parties.

Analysis Notes
Amendment Since initial award the End Date has been extended from 12/19/24 to 10/19/26 and the total obligations have increased 257% from $2,501,631 to $8,931,659.
Texas A&M Engineering Experiment Station was awarded DARPA BTO Arcadia Program: Microbes Resisting Rust - Armor Cooperative Agreement HR00112320006 worth $8,931,659 from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ency in December 2022 with work to be completed primarily in College Station Texas United States. The grant has a duration of 3 years 10 months and was awarded through assistance program 12.910 Research and Technology Development.
